jaz*_*000 7 sql-server visual-studio
我们有一个安装过程,作为安装的一部分,它会调用 SqlPackage 将 dacpac 文件与该特定客户端的数据库进行比较,并更新任何数据更改。
我们遇到的问题是,根据 Sql Server 的版本和 SQL Server Data Tools 的版本,我们必须选择正确版本的 sqlpackage.exe 才能使用。
我们使用的当前进程在文件夹中查找
C:\Program Files (x86)\Microsoft SQL Server\140\Dac\bin\ 并向下循环 130、120、110 以查找可用的最高版本
不幸的是,最新版本可能安装在 Visual Studio 子文件夹中
C:\Program Files (x86)\Microsoft Visual Studio 14.0\Common7\IDE\Extensions\Microsoft\SQLDB\DAC\130
是否有任何元数据可供我们查询,以确定给定服务器上现有的最高版本 SqlPackage 是什么,以及在哪里可以找到它?
| 归档时间: |
|
| 查看次数: |
1802 次 |
| 最近记录: |